Discovering Tiffin's Landscapes
The journey begins at the edges of Tiffin, where rolling hills and fertile plains stretch as far as the eye can see. The changing seasons bring a dynamic beauty to these landscapes. In spring, wildflowers blanket the ground in a mosaic of colors, while autumn transforms the foliage into a fiery display of oranges, reds, and yellows. Photographers will find these seasons perfect for capturing vibrant landscapes and the serene beauty of Tiffin’s natural surroundings.
A short hike from the city center leads to the Clear Creek Trail, a favorite among locals for its accessibility and stunning views. The trail winds along Clear Creek, framed by dense woodlands that are home to diverse wildlife. Early mornings on the trail are magical, with golden sunlight filtering through the trees and morning mist hovering over the creek. It’s an ideal setting for those looking to capture ethereal woodland scenes and the lively spirit of the creek.

Water Wonders
Tiffin is also blessed with beautiful water bodies that add a dynamic element to its landscape. The Coralville Reservoir, located just a short drive from Tiffin, is a haven for both wildlife enthusiasts and photographers. The reservoir's vast waters reflect the sky, creating stunning symmetrical compositions during sunrise and sunset. The surrounding areas, with their abundant birdlife and verdant growth, offer endless opportunities for wildlife photography and scenic shots.
Photographing the small streams that trickle through the outskirts of the city can also be rewarding. These areas are often overlooked, yet they hold a subtle beauty. Capturing the movement of water with a slow shutter speed here can result in mesmerizing images that convey the serene flow of nature.
Wildlife and Flora
For those interested in wildlife photography, Tiffin’s natural reserves are home to a variety of birds, deer, and smaller mammals. The key to wildlife photography is patience and the right timing; early mornings or late afternoons are when animals are most active. Whether it's a deer drinking from a creek or birds chirping on tree branches, capturing these moments requires a keen eye and a readiness to embrace the unexpected.
The local flora, from towering oak trees to delicate wildflowers, provides ample subjects for macro photography and offers a detailed look at the region’s biodiversity. The intricate patterns of leaves and flowers, the textures of bark, and the interplay of light and shadow can all transform a simple plant into a striking photographic subject.
